DBEDT RELEASES 2023 STATE OF HAWAI‘I DATA BOOK
HONOLULU – The Department of Business, Economic Development and Tourism (DBEDT) today released the 2023 edition of the State of Hawai‘i Data Book. The Data Book is the 56th edition of its series.
The Hawai‘i State Data Book is the most comprehensive statistical book about Hawai‘i in a single compilation. Classified into 24 sections with 845 data tables, it covers a broad range of information in areas such as population, education, environment, economics, energy, real estate, construction, business enterprises, government, tourism and transportation.
The book is in electronic form and is available on the DBEDT website at: dbedt.hawaii.gov/economic/databook. The data tables can be downloaded in whole or in part as either PDF or Excel files.
“The Data Book has been around over half of a century and has been one of the most popular products DBEDT offers to the public. The book is an essential tool for people to know Hawai‘i’s history, current situation and future development,” said DBEDT Director James Kunane Tokioka. “Our researchers also produced two products based on the data book. One of them is the County Social, Business and Economic Trends and the other is the Data Book Time Series; both can be found on our website.”
